- The Connecticut Office of the Inspector General released bodycam footage that shows Officer Kyle Busse firing from inside a cruiser during the pursuit on I-84 West.
- Manchester police say the encounter began around 1:40 a.m. with a traffic stop on Center Street and continued onto the highway after stop sticks punctured the fleeing car’s tires.
- Police report that Samuel Lee fired several rounds at officers and struck at least one cruiser before Busse returned fire and hit Lee in the hip.
- Lee surrendered at the scene and was hospitalized with non-life-threatening injuries, and I-84 West reopened after being closed for several hours.
- The Hartford State’s Attorney obtained an arrest warrant charging Lee with multiple felonies, and police say he also has six outstanding rearrest warrants.
